execrable

adjective

Pronunciation

ˈɛksɪkɹəbl

Audio pronunciation

Parts of speech

Definitions

adjective

  1. deserving to be execrated

adjective

  1. unequivocally detestable

adjective

  1. of very poor quality or condition
